Troubleshooting FaceTime for Mac
You can make FaceTime calls using the FaceTime app. You can call FaceTime users whose contact information is in Contacts. You can add contacts and edit contact information in either FaceTime or Contacts. To place a video call, you may use a phone number or email address.
If you encounter issues making or receiving FaceTime calls, try the following:
Verify that FaceTime is enabled in FaceTime > Preferences.If the issue persists, or if you see the message "Waiting for Activation", try toggling FaceTime off and then on.
Verify that the Date, Time, and Time Zone are set correctly:
From the Apple () menu, choose System Preferences > Date & Time > Date & Time.
Enable "Set Automatically".
Click the Time Zone tab and confirm the closest city is correct

  • Outlook to iPhone sync failure – Sync suddenly stopped working for calendar events but continued for contacts and notes.   Finally Fixed!!!  SUPPORT TEAM – PLEASE SEE THIS – Complete explanation of cause and correction steps.

    The issue:  Outlook to iPhone sync failure – Sync suddenly stopped working for calendar events but continued for contacts and notes.   Finally Fixed!!! 
    SUPPORT TEAM – PLEASE SEE THIS – Complete explanation of cause and correction steps.
    The cause:  It is now clear what caused this problem.  For years I had several “all-day” events in my Outlook calendar (birthdays, anniversaries, etc.).  In May 2012 I decided to make some of them one hour  events so I could add alerts to remind me of the event.  I did this by dragging them in Outlook to the time I wanted and expanding them to the time slot desired and then adding the alarm.
    The symptom:  Syncing stopped working for the calendar but continued working for contacts and notes.  I didn’t realize sync was failing until months later when I missed two very important phone calls, so when I noticed it the cause was not obvious. 
    The failed attempts:  I’m head of a software firm and my calendar sync is a crucial to my business life so I took this on with a vengeance.  From a quick look at events in Outlook and the iPhone I could see that the problem started in May 2012.  Events before May were in both Outlook and the iPhone but events after May were only one or the other.  Unfortunately I had changed several other things at the same time relating to other events so again the cause was not obvious.  MANY calls with AppleCare proved them incompetent so my internal IT guys assisted trying many things.  We tried a huge number of calendar changes and several versions of iTunes, iPhone OS and Office as well as both iPhone 4 and 5, all without success.
    The fix:  After 18 months of frustration, MANY  hundreds of $ expense and MANY hours of wasted time I saw a blog that had a calendar sync  problem and it indicated all day events were related.  I changed the display of the Outlook calendar to the list view, added columns so I could see “all day” event check marks as well as times of events,  sorted on the “all day” event column to move them to the top, and for all events that were “all day” events AND had a start and end time, I removed recurrence and then added the annual recurrence back…
    After I fixed all events that had BOTH “all day” set and had a start/end time, I tried another sync.  It synced for the first time in 18 months! 
    Problem occurred May 2012 – fixed Nov 2013

    Hi, to remove dummy '_ModGrp' entries, rather than crashing the 'Suppr' key on your keyboard, you can use this basic VBA macro (launched for instance from Excel).
    It will recursively remove all '_ModGrp...' folders
    Sub RemoveFolders_Click()
        Dim oOutlook As Outlook.Application
        Set oOutlook = New Outlook.Application
        Set objNameSpace = oOutlook.GetNamespace("MAPI")
        Call CleanFolders(objNameSpace.Folders)
    End Sub
    Sub CleanFolders(objFolders As Outlook.Folders)
        For i = objFolders.Count To 1 Step -1
            If Left(objFolders(i).Name, 7) = "_ModGrp" Then
                objFolders.Remove( i )
            Else
                If Not objFolders(i).Folders Is Nothing Then
                    Call CleanFolders(objFolders(i).Folders)
                End If
            End If
        Next i
    End Sub
